Q: Is 316,467 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 316,467 is a composite number.

Why is 316,467 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 316,467 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 27 81 3,907 11,721 35,163 105,489 and 316,467, with no remainder.

Since 316,467 cannot be divided by just 1 and 316,467, it is a composite number.
